NatWest Group is hiring a Technology Business Analyst for its Digital X division in Chennai, India. This role is offered at the Associate level and is ideal for professionals with strong business analysis expertise, automation exposure, and Agile delivery experience who want to contribute to large-scale digital transformation in banking.
This position plays a critical role in shaping secure, efficient, and customer-centric digital solutions across NatWest’s technology landscape.

As a Technology Business Analyst, you will support NatWest’s digital strategy by understanding business needs and translating them into clear, actionable technology requirements. You’ll work closely with stakeholders, delivery teams, and customers to ensure solutions align with business objectives while improving efficiency, automation, and customer experience.
This role offers excellent exposure to enterprise-scale automation, AI-driven solutions, and modern Agile delivery practices.
